China said on Tuesday it had issued a "strong protest" in talks with Japanese representatives in Beijing. The talks were held to dampen a diplomatic dispute triggered by comments made by the new Japanese Prime Minister Sanae Takaichi over Taiwan . The fallout has seen China urge its citizens not to travel to Japan, with Tokyo responding by warning its own citizens in China to step up precautions.
